How much do fire safety code officer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for fire safety code officer in the United States is $67,068.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$47,500.00 and $80,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What You’ll Do: As a Fire & Life Safety Director with Alliance Security, you’ll be the go-to leader for fire and life safety operations at Class A commercial sites. Your role will be crucial in ensuring preparedness, compliance, and rapid response to any emergency.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Primary Safety Contact: Lead fire and life safety operations across your assigned property
  • Emergency Planning: Develop, implement, and continuously refine fire safety and emergency response plans
  • Conduct Fire Drills & Training: Run regular fire drills, conduct comprehensive safety inspections, and train staff
  • System Oversight: Ensure the functionality and compliance of fire alarm, sprinkler, and suppression systems
  • Collaborate & Communicate: Coordinate with building management, tenants, and emergency agencies during crises
  • Regulation Compliance: Stay informed about NYC fire safety regulations and implement updates as necessary
  • Lead During Emergencies: Act decisively in emergencies, providing calm and effective leadership
  • Record-Keeping: Maintain detailed logs of safety activities, drills, and incident reports

In addition, you’ll assist with general Security Officer duties as required, helping to ensure a comprehensive safety approach.

What We’re Looking For:

  • F-89 Certification (required; valid for at least 6 months beyond hire date)
  • NYS Security Guard License (required; valid for at least 3 months beyond hire date)
  • Experience: At least 2 years as a Fire & Life Safety Director in NYC commercial property
  • In-Depth Knowledge: Familiar with NYC fire safety codes and commercial building systems
